Atom Computing is seeking an Senior Optical Engineer to lead the design of opto-mechanical subsystems and to drive their build out and develop fixtures and processes for their precision alignment and assembly.
Job Responsibilities
Lead cross-functional partnerships with mechanical engineers and physicists to iteratively design optical subsystems in the areas of laser distribution, high numerical aperture microscope imaging, and optical cavities
Define system architecture and make critical strategic decisions for balancing competing requirements.
Create novel designs and specifications of optical systems and subsystems from the component level up to the system level
Evaluate suitability of design solutions by performing detailed tolerance and stray light analysis
Develop alignment procedures for optical designs
Lead hands-on assembly and precision alignment of finalized optical designs
Characterize the performance of optical subsystems
